Crane Operator (15 Tons - 500 Tons)

Pakistan

Department
Maintenance

Position
Crane Operator (15 Tons-500 Tons)

Location
Reko Diq Mine Site – Balochistan

Qualification
  • HTV license is required along with Third party certification for operation of all Mobile cranes KATO, Tadano, XCMG, Grove & SANY Cranes & with specific experience in operation of 15 to 100 Tons capacity cranes.
  • High school diploma or equivalent qualification; additional training or certification in crane operation is preferred.

Experience
  • Minimum of 5 -10 years of experience as a crane operator, with proficiency in operating large-capacity cranes in construction or along with Load chart awareness.
  • Age Limit: Less than 50 years

Requirements
  • Strong knowledge of load charts, rigging, and lifting techniques.
  • Familiarity with OSHA regulations and crane operation safety standards.
  • Good hand-eye coordination and depth perception.
  • Ability to work in high-pressure environments.
  • Mechanical aptitude and basic troubleshooting skills.
  • Effective communication and teamwork.

Responsibilities
  • Conduct daily equipment inspections to ensure the crane is in good working condition.
  • Operate cranes to lift, move, or position loads as per site requirements.
  • Read and interpret load charts, work orders and signal instructions.
  • Perform routine maintenance such as lubrication and minor repairs and report major malfunctions to maintenance staff.
  • Comply with all safety regulations and RDMC procedures.
  • Communicate effectively with riggers, signalers, and supervisors to coordinate lifting activities.
  • Monitor crane operation to detect problems and take corrective action as necessary.
  • Set up cranes at job sites, ensuring proper leveling, blocking, and stabilizing based on ground conditions and lift requirements.
  • Follow lifting plans and assist in planning lifts involving complex or heavy loads.
  • Maintain accurate records of work performed and inspections completed.
  • Assist in loading and unloading materials when required.
  • Recognize and respond to emergency situations, such as mechanical failure or hazardous conditions, promptly and appropriately.
